What ⁢is Game-Based ⁣Learning?

⁤ Game-based ‍learning (GBL) is an educational approach ‍where students use games to ⁤achieve specific learning objectives.These can be‌ digital educational ​games, gamified classroom activities, or simulations designed to reinforce subject matter. Unlike simple gamification​ (such as adding points or badges), GBL centers the‌ game​ as the learning vehicle, ⁤making lessons interactive,‍ immersive, and fun.

Key benefits According to Students

  • Increased motivation: Students report higher enthusiasm for lessons when⁣ games‍ are involved, transforming learning from a “must-do” to⁣ a “want-to-do” activity.
  • Active Participation: Games inspire‌ shy or reluctant learners to participate more, thanks to their dynamic and inclusive formats.
  • Immediate Feedback: Many educational games provide instant‍ feedback,allowing students to learn from mistakes without⁢ delay.
  • Knowledge ‌Retention: Interactive and multisensory experiences help solidify data,making it easier for students⁢ to recall concepts later.
  • Collaboration & Social Skills: Multiplayer or team-based games promote healthy competition, teamwork, and dialogue among peers.
  • Safe Learning Habitat: Students feel‌ more agreeable taking risks and experimenting, as games often frame setbacks⁣ as natural‍ parts of​ the learning process.

Case Studies: Game-Based Learning in action

Case Study 1: Digital ‍Quests in Language Arts

⁤ At Oakridge Middle school, the English department integrated a digital quest⁣ game to teach literary devices. Over a ‌semester, students reported a 35% increase⁣ in engagement and a ‌28% betterment in assessment scores compared ​to traditional lessons. Student surveys highlighted improvements in critical thinking⁣ and a newfound enthusiasm for reading ⁢assignments.

Case study 2: Math with MinecraftEdu

In a sixth-grade math class, teachers used MinecraftEdu to demonstrate concepts like area, perimeter, and proportions. Students collaboratively⁤ built structures while applying theoretical knowledge. teachers‍ observed ⁢a substantial boost in classroom participation, and over 90% of ‌students agreed that math concepts “made more sense” after the game-based activities.

Case Study 3: Science Simulations for Experimentation

‌ High school science teachers incorporated virtual labs and physics games. Students ‍could safely experiment and visualize results instantly,leading to a deeper understanding of abstract concepts. ⁢Feedback indicated that students appreciated the opportunity to “fail safely” and⁣ learn from their mistakes.

Practical tips for Integrating Game-Based Learning

  • Start Small: Begin with ⁢short, simple games before implementing more complex ​or digital‍ game solutions.
  • Align With Learning Goals: Ensure​ your chosen games support and reinforce curriculum⁢ objectives.
  • Gather Student Feedback: Regularly solicit input to understand what works and what needs adjustment.
  • Mix Digital & Physical Games: Balance screen time with hands-on activities for a ⁤varied classroom experience.
  • Promote Collaboration: Select multiplayer or team-based games to ⁤nurture communication and teamwork.
  • Reflect & ‌Reiterate: Use class discussions after games to connect experiences with learning outcomes.

Challenges & considerations

While game-based ‍learning offers many benefits, it’s not ⁢without challenges. Some students may initially resist change, or technological resources might be limited.Additionally, careful moderation is needed to keep fun⁣ and competition in balance with learning objectives. Teachers should remain mindful of inclusivity, ⁤ensuring that all ‍students feel comfortable participating.
